Nygard
Cay boasts of water slides, a human aquarium and countless
Jacuzzis. The 32,000 ft2 grand-hall with a 100,000 lb glass
ceiling is stunning in appearance. Hundreds of craftsmen
from Hollywood and Canada used tons of stone to create this
colossal pre-Columbian structure. The Cay is inspired by
the Mayan civilian which had some of the finest architecture
throughout the history of the world.
